Chinmaya (@ChinmayaSaxena) reported@Paytm Data leak risks worth considering if not considered and addressed already. Maybe good for the @Paytm team to share how these are addressed. This is again in our long term interest as a nation. Quoted directly from Claude response (disclaimer- Not my personal views, please validate) 1. Prompt injection via tool outputs. Transaction descriptions, customer names, order notes — any field an end-customer can populate — becomes untrusted text once it flows through the MCP tool result into Claude's context. A malicious "customer" could put an injection payload in a payment note field, hoping it gets executed when a merchant later asks Claude to "summarize today's transactions." 2. Over-broad OAuth scopes. If the merchant's connected token grants read access to all transactions rather than scoped by team/role, any employee with Claude access effectively gets visibility into full settlement and customer data, bypassing whatever RBAC existed on the Paytm dashboard. 3. Context leakage across conversations/sessions. If the same Claude account is used for other tasks, payment data pulled into context in one thread could plausibly resurface via memory/summarization features if not carefully scoped — worth checking how PPSL scopes token lifetime and whether Claude retains tool outputs beyond the session. 4. Third-party model exposure. Payment data (PII: names, phone numbers, partial card/bank details, amounts) now transits through Anthropic's infrastructure as tool-call payloads, even if not used for training. That's a new data-residency and compliance surface — relevant for RBI data localization rules and PCI-DSS scope creep. 5. Credential/session hijacking. MCP connector auth tokens, if long-lived, become a single high-value target — compromise of the Claude account (weak password, no 2FA, shared device) could give an attacker read access to a merchant's entire payment history. 6. No mention of masking. The post doesn't say whether sensitive fields (card BINs, UPI VPAs, customer PII) are redacted/tokenized before reaching the LLM context — a real gap for a blog post about a payments integration. 🙏
